musicblocks
musicblocks copied to clipboard
[CI] Extending CI Tests for macOS Platform
Current Behavior
TThe existing GitHub Actions workflow only supports the Ubuntu-20.04 platform.
Desired Behavior
The workflow should be expanded to include testing on macOS and potentially other platforms to ensure comprehensive validation and compatibility checks.
Implementation
Extend the GitHub Actions workflow to include support for macOS or other platforms, allowing comprehensive testing across multiple operating systems. This enhancement would ensure broader compatibility and a more comprehensive validation process for the codebase.
Acceptance Tests
- [x] I have read and followed the project's code of conduct.
- [x] I have searched for similar issues before creating this one.
- [x] I have provided all the necessary information to understand and reproduce the issue.
- [x] I am willing to contribute to the resolution of this issue.
Checklist
- [x] Platform Expansion.
Thank you for contributing to our project! We appreciate your help in improving it.
π See contributing instructions.
ππΎππΌ Questions: Community Matrix Server.